Can You Master Cyber Security Without Formal Training?


As a cyber security expert with years of experience under my belt, I often get asked if it’s possible to master cyber security without any formal training. It’s a question that’s on the minds of so many individuals who are looking to break into the field and it’s not hard to understand why. The idea of mastering a complex field like cyber security without the guidance of formal education can often feel daunting. However, I’m here to tell you that it is absolutely possible to become a proficient cyber security expert without going through a traditional program. In fact, I believe that with the right mindset, mentality, and approach, anyone can master cyber security – even without the extensive training that many believe is necessary. Let’s dive in and explore how you can become a cyber security expert without the need for formal training.

Can you self teach cyber security?

Yes, you can teach yourself cyber security. With the abundance of free information and resources available online, self-taught cyber security experts can be just as skilled as those with formal education in the field. However, mastering cyber security on your own can be challenging and requires a high level of dedication and self-discipline. Here are some tips for successfully self-teaching cyber security:

  • Start with the basics: Before diving into advanced topics, make sure you have a strong understanding of the fundamentals. Learn about the different types of cyber attacks, common vulnerabilities, and security best practices.
  • Take advantage of free resources: There are numerous online resources available, including blogs, forums, videos, and tutorials. Visit cybersecurity websites and forums, join online communities, and follow industry experts on social media.
  • Practice, practice, practice: The best way to develop your skills is by hands-on practice. Set up a virtual lab environment where you can experiment with different security tools and techniques.
  • Stay up to date: Cyber security is a rapidly evolving field, and it’s essential to stay current with the latest threats and trends. Attend conferences, read industry reports, and subscribe to cybersecurity publications.
  • Find a mentor: Having a mentor who can guide you and provide feedback on your work can be invaluable. Reach out to experienced cyber security professionals and ask for advice or mentorship.
  • Remember that self-teaching cyber security requires time and effort. It’s essential to set goals, stay motivated, and be persistent in your learning journey. By following these tips and investing in your education, you can become a skilled cyber security expert on your own terms.

    ???? Pro Tips:

    1. Start with the Basics – To begin self-teaching cyber security, start by learning the fundamentals. Topics like encryption, network protocols, and password security are good places to start.

    2. Utilize Online Resources – There are a plethora of online resources available for those wanting to learn about cyber security. Websites like Cybrary and Coursera offer free courses, while cybersecurity blogs and forums offer valuable tips and insights.

    3. Get Hands-On Experience – To truly learn cybersecurity, one must have practical experience. Try setting up a virtual lab environment on your home computer and practice implementing security measures.

    4. Look for Mentorship Opportunities – Networking with seasoned cybersecurity professionals can give you a mentor who can guide you through the ups and downs of self-teaching. Consider joining cybersecurity groups or attending conferences.

    5. Keep Learning – Cybersecurity is an ever-changing field, so it’s important to continue learning and stay up-to-date with the latest threats and best practices. Subscribe to security newsletters and attend industry events to ensure you are always growing in your knowledge.

    The Viability of Self-Teaching Cybersecurity

    In recent years, cybersecurity has become an increasingly important and in-demand field. As technology advances, the risks to our digital infrastructure also escalate. Cybercrime rates have skyrocketed, and it’s essential for businesses and individuals to protect themselves from hackers, malware, and other cyber threats.

    Cybersecurity may seem like a daunting subject, and many people assume that achieving expert-level knowledge requires obtaining a formal education. However, the reality is that self-taught cybersecurity experts can be as skilled and knowledgeable as those who have graduated with a degree in cybersecurity.

    The Importance of Passion and Discipline

    Although it’s possible to teach oneself cybersecurity, it’s far from easy. As with any subject, success requires dedication, passion, and discipline. Cybersecurity is a dynamic field that’s constantly changing, which means that anyone looking to self-teach must continually keep up with new information, trends, and threats.

    Passion and discipline are critical because cybersecurity requires tackling complex problems that often involve obscure topics, making it challenging to stay motivated. Self-teaching in cybersecurity means pursuing knowledge and skills without guidance and support from a formal educational environment. It’s not for everyone, and those with an innate love for the field are more likely to succeed.

    The Pros and Cons of Self-Teaching Cybersecurity


    • Flexibility: Self-learning provides flexibility in terms of schedule and pace. One can balance their studies with other responsibilities without any pressure.
    • Cost-Effective: It eliminates the high cost of tuition fees, textbooks, and other educational expenses associated with traditional education.
    • Self-acquired skills: One learns logical and self-acquired skills through self-learning. These skills enhance the problem-solving approach, which is a significant advantage in cybersecurity.
    • Opportunity to specialize in specific areas: Unlike formal cybersecurity training, one can focus and specialize in their area of interest. This approach provides room to become an expert in specific fields.


    • Limited Job Opportunities: Self-Taught cybersecurity professionals may find that they can’t compete with those who have formal training when it comes to job opportunities. Many employers, especially in high-security industries, require formal certification and accreditation.
    • No Recognition: Self-learning won’t earn one recognition from professional bodies unless they pass their certifications.
    • No peers or mentors for personal development: Learning through self-taught cybersecurity means a lack of interaction and professional guidance from peers.
    • Time-consuming: The self-learning process can be time-consuming, which might discourage some people and distract them from other important responsibilities.

    Developing Expertise without a Formal Cybersecurity Education

    Success in the cybersecurity field depends on mastering a range of skills that are challenging to learn without guidance or resources. While many people assume that acquiring such knowledge requires attending a traditional cybersecurity program or obtaining an advanced degree, the self-taught approach can be just as effective.

    However, what’s essential is to identify the specific cybersecurity knowledge and skills to acquire; often, learning from books, online resources, and following experts in the cybersecurity sector can be helpful. Building a foundation from the fundamentals and progressing gradually to experience the practical process is crucial.

    Practice and experimentation with various technologies on different platforms is key to becoming an expert without formal educational accreditation.

    Strategies for Effective Self-Teaching in Cybersecurity

    As with any field, there are different methods to approach self-teaching in cybersecurity.

    Here are some strategies for effective self-teaching in cybersecurity:

    • Identify your learning objectives: You should be clear about what you want to achieve through self-teaching cybersecurity. This will help you set your goals, direct your focus, and work more efficiently.
    • Take advantage of online resources: Use free online resources to learn more about cybersecurity concepts and skills, such as video tutorials, online courses, and communities for learning and support.
    • Practice, practice, practice: Practical experience and skill development are crucial in becoming an expert in cybersecurity. Developing practical skills may involve experimenting with platforms and identifying vulnerabilities, protecting systems, and mitigating cyber threats.
    • Participate in cybersecurity challenges: Participating in capture the flag (CTF) challenges or cybersecurity competitions is an exciting way to challenge and sharpen your cybersecurity knowledge.

    Managing Your Cybersecurity Knowledge Gap

    As with any field, knowledge gaps can be a problem for self-taught cybersecurity professionals. It’s essential to identify gaps in knowledge and address them systematically as they occur. Researching extensively for answers using relevant resources, attending cybersecurity training groups, can be helpful.

    Applying innovative skills techniques to reflect on your learning, such as blogging, delivering presentations on a particular topic, creating an eBook or writing articles in cybersecurity helps reinforce and deepen one’s knowledge.

    Tools and Resources for Self-Taught Cybersecurity Professionals

    There are several tools and resources available to self-taught cybersecurity professionals. Accessing them helps in acquiring and deepening knowledge in different areas of cybersecurity.

    Here are some of the tools and resources available:

    • Virtual Labs: Cybersecurity virtual labs provide environments designed to create scenarios for testing and experimentation on secure platforms.
    • Cybrary: An online resource website offering free cybersecurity courseware for self-learning that covers the latest certification requirements.
    • YouTube: YouTube offers a wealth of tutorials, videos, and informative content on cybersecurity.
    • Cyber Aces: Cyber Aces provides a free online course on cybersecurity that provides an excellent foundation for aspiring cybersecurity professionals.


    Self-teaching cybersecurity is a viable way to become an expert in the field. With the current demand for cybersecurity professionals, there has never been a better time to start learning. However, the journey is rocky and requires passion, discipline, and perseverance. With time, the skills learned become just as valuable as a formal degree in cybersecurity, and the door to limitless cybersecurity opportunities opens.